A teenager who trespassed onto railway lines has been handed a stay in a youth detention centre.
The youngster made their way onto the c2c lines in Pitsea and delayed trains by 235 minutes.
A spokesmen for British Transport Police said: "A 16-year-old was caught trespassing in the c2c line in Pitsea resulting in 235 worth of train delay minutes and costing £11,551.
"They were found guilty at court along with additional Essex Police offences and they received a total of two years in youth detention of which four months were for railway trespass."
